1 definition by Nick Barrett IIII

Top Definition
Origin - The University of Birmingham - a chap rather accustomed to brightly coloured trousers.

Commonly used, though ill approved term (especially when uttered in the presence of a female) making reference to the genitalia of a female/general presence of a female.

Favoured most notably for its distinct onomatopoeic effect.
"Excuse me gwatch"

"Alright gwatch"

"Her gwatch flaps are epically large"
by Nick Barrett IIII June 30, 2009

The Urban Dictionary Mug

One side has the word, one side has the definition. Microwave and dishwasher safe. Lotsa space for your liquids.

Buy the mug